Transaction 163b1380840a2072611e99598d10943c8d2e94dc5b1c596440667eaf3b8c589e
1 Input
1 Output
-
163b1380840a2072611e99598d10943c8d2e94dc5b1c596440667eaf3b8c589e:0
- value
- 3005399
- script pubkey
- OP_0 OP_PUSHBYTES_20 3e525895c0603350ef38fe039c15bb6a9ebe3d8b
- address
- bc1q8ef939wqvqe4pmeclcpec9dmd20tu0vt95zkkx